Total synthesis of (12R)- and (12S)-12-hydroxymonocerins: stereoselective oxylactonization using a chiral hypervalent iodine(iii) species?

RSC Advances Pub Date: 2013-07-24 DOI: 10.1039/C3RA43230K

Abstract

The first total syntheses of (12R)- and (12S)-12-hydroxymonocerins are described. The oxolane-fused isochroman-1-one framework is stereoselectively constructed via a double oxy-cyclization using a lactate-based chiral hypervalent iodine reagent. A catalytic variant of the double oxy-cyclization is also demonstrated using a chiral iodoarene as the precatalyst and m-CPBA as the co-oxidant.
